What is included

  • Measurement plan, what decisions the data has to support, agreed before any tags
  • Data layer designed rather than improvised
  • GA4 with clean event naming and proper ecommerce parameters
  • Server-side tagging where ad-blocking or accuracy justifies it
  • Consent handling aligned to DPDP expectations
  • Validation against real transactions, because most tracking is quietly wrong

Our GA4 numbers do not match our orders. Why?

Usually ad blocking, consent handling, or a tag firing at the wrong moment. Reconciliation against your order data identifies which, and server-side tagging closes much of the gap.

Do we need server-side tracking?

It helps where ad blocking is significant or where you need control over what reaches third parties. It has real setup and running cost, so it should be justified rather than defaulted to.

Can you fix an existing messy setup?

Yes, and it is common work. We audit what fires today, map it against what you actually need, and rebuild the container cleanly.
